Solar Collector

Term from Solar Energy Production industry explained for recruiters

A Solar Collector is a key device in solar energy systems that captures sunlight and converts it into useful heat. Think of it like a specialized panel that's different from regular solar panels (which make electricity) - these collect heat instead. They're commonly used in solar water heating systems for homes, swimming pools, or industrial processes. When you see this term in resumes, it usually indicates experience with solar thermal systems, which is different from solar electric (photovoltaic) systems. Other common names for this technology include "solar thermal collector," "solar thermal panel," or "solar hot water panel."

Example Interview Questions

Senior Level Questions

Q: How would you approach designing a large-scale solar collector system for an industrial facility?

Expected Answer: A senior professional should discuss site assessment, heat load calculations, system sizing, integration with existing systems, and consideration of factors like climate, budget, and maintenance requirements.

Q: What methods do you use to optimize solar collector system performance?

Expected Answer: Should explain monitoring techniques, maintenance schedules, efficiency improvements, and troubleshooting methods for both individual collectors and entire systems.

Mid Level Questions

Q: What are the main types of solar collectors and their applications?

Expected Answer: Should be able to explain different types like flat-plate collectors, evacuated tubes, and concentrating collectors, along with their best use cases and limitations.

Q: How do you determine the proper sizing for a solar collector system?

Expected Answer: Should discuss factors like daily hot water usage, climate conditions, available roof space, and backup heating requirements.

Junior Level Questions

Q: What are the basic components of a solar collector system?

Expected Answer: Should identify main parts like the collector panel, storage tank, heat transfer fluid, pumps, and controls, explaining their basic functions.

Q: What safety procedures do you follow when installing solar collectors?

Expected Answer: Should mention roof safety, proper handling of equipment, heat transfer fluid safety, and following local building codes and regulations.
